├── .gitignore ├── Readme.md ├── deep_sdf ├── __init__.py ├── data.py ├── loss.py ├── lr_schedule.py ├── mesh.py ├── metrics │ ├── chamfer.py │ └── emd.py ├── utils.py └── workspace.py ├── environment.yaml ├── evaluate.py ├── examples ├── cars_dit │ └── specs.json ├── chairs_dit │ └── specs.json ├── planes_dit │ └── specs.json ├── sofas_dit │ └── specs.json └── splits │ ├── sv2_cars_test.json │ ├── sv2_cars_train.json │ ├── sv2_chairs1_train.json │ ├── sv2_chairs2_train.json │ ├── sv2_chairs_test.json │ ├── sv2_chairs_train.json │ ├── sv2_planes_test.json │ ├── sv2_planes_train.json │ ├── sv2_sofas_test.json │ ├── sv2_sofas_train.json │ ├── sv2_tables_test.json │ └── sv2_tables_train.json ├── generate_meshes_correspondence.py ├── generate_template_mesh.py ├── generate_training_meshes.py ├── networks └── deep_implicit_template_decoder.py ├── objio.py ├── plot_log.py ├── plot_log_multiple.py ├── pretrained ├── cars_dit │ ├── LatentCodes │ │ ├── 2000.pth │ │ └── latest.pth │ ├── ModelParameters │ │ ├── 2000.pth │ │ └── latest.pth │ └── specs.json ├── chairs_dit │ ├── LatentCodes │ │ ├── 2000.pth │ │ └── latest.pth │ ├── ModelParameters │ │ ├── 2000.pth │ │ └── latest.pth │ └── specs.json ├── planes_dit │ ├── LatentCodes │ │ ├── 2000.pth │ │ └── latest.pth │ ├── ModelParameters │ │ ├── 2000.pth │ │ └── latest.pth │ └── specs.json └── sofas_dit │ ├── LatentCodes │ ├── 2000.pth │ └── latest.pth │ ├── ModelParameters │ ├── 2000.pth │ └── latest.pth │ └── specs.json ├── reconstruct_deep_implicit_templates.py ├── render_correspondences.py └── train_deep_implicit_templates.py /.gitignore: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/ZhengZerong/DeepImplicitTemplates/HEAD/.gitignore -------------------------------------------------------------------------------- /Readme.md: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/ZhengZerong/DeepImplicitTemplates/HEAD/Readme.md -------------------------------------------------------------------------------- /deep_sdf/__init__.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/ZhengZerong/DeepImplicitTemplates/HEAD/deep_sdf/__init__.py -------------------------------------------------------------------------------- /deep_sdf/data.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/ZhengZerong/DeepImplicitTemplates/HEAD/deep_sdf/data.py -------------------------------------------------------------------------------- /deep_sdf/loss.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/ZhengZerong/DeepImplicitTemplates/HEAD/deep_sdf/loss.py -------------------------------------------------------------------------------- /deep_sdf/lr_schedule.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/ZhengZerong/DeepImplicitTemplates/HEAD/deep_sdf/lr_schedule.py -------------------------------------------------------------------------------- /deep_sdf/mesh.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/ZhengZerong/DeepImplicitTemplates/HEAD/deep_sdf/mesh.py -------------------------------------------------------------------------------- /deep_sdf/metrics/chamfer.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/ZhengZerong/DeepImplicitTemplates/HEAD/deep_sdf/metrics/chamfer.py -------------------------------------------------------------------------------- /deep_sdf/metrics/emd.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/ZhengZerong/DeepImplicitTemplates/HEAD/deep_sdf/metrics/emd.py -------------------------------------------------------------------------------- /deep_sdf/utils.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/ZhengZerong/DeepImplicitTemplates/HEAD/deep_sdf/utils.py -------------------------------------------------------------------------------- /deep_sdf/workspace.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/ZhengZerong/DeepImplicitTemplates/HEAD/deep_sdf/workspace.py -------------------------------------------------------------------------------- /environment.yaml: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/ZhengZerong/DeepImplicitTemplates/HEAD/environment.yaml -------------------------------------------------------------------------------- /evaluate.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/ZhengZerong/DeepImplicitTemplates/HEAD/evaluate.py -------------------------------------------------------------------------------- /examples/cars_dit/specs.json: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/ZhengZerong/DeepImplicitTemplates/HEAD/examples/cars_dit/specs.json -------------------------------------------------------------------------------- /examples/chairs_dit/specs.json: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/ZhengZerong/DeepImplicitTemplates/HEAD/examples/chairs_dit/specs.json -------------------------------------------------------------------------------- /examples/planes_dit/specs.json: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/ZhengZerong/DeepImplicitTemplates/HEAD/examples/planes_dit/specs.json -------------------------------------------------------------------------------- /examples/sofas_dit/specs.json: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/ZhengZerong/DeepImplicitTemplates/HEAD/examples/sofas_dit/specs.json -------------------------------------------------------------------------------- /examples/splits/sv2_cars_test.json: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/ZhengZerong/DeepImplicitTemplates/HEAD/examples/splits/sv2_cars_test.json -------------------------------------------------------------------------------- /examples/splits/sv2_cars_train.json: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/ZhengZerong/DeepImplicitTemplates/HEAD/examples/splits/sv2_cars_train.json -------------------------------------------------------------------------------- /examples/splits/sv2_chairs1_train.json: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/ZhengZerong/DeepImplicitTemplates/HEAD/examples/splits/sv2_chairs1_train.json -------------------------------------------------------------------------------- /examples/splits/sv2_chairs2_train.json: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/ZhengZerong/DeepImplicitTemplates/HEAD/examples/splits/sv2_chairs2_train.json -------------------------------------------------------------------------------- /examples/splits/sv2_chairs_test.json: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/ZhengZerong/DeepImplicitTemplates/HEAD/examples/splits/sv2_chairs_test.json -------------------------------------------------------------------------------- /examples/splits/sv2_chairs_train.json: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/ZhengZerong/DeepImplicitTemplates/HEAD/examples/splits/sv2_chairs_train.json -------------------------------------------------------------------------------- /examples/splits/sv2_planes_test.json: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/ZhengZerong/DeepImplicitTemplates/HEAD/examples/splits/sv2_planes_test.json -------------------------------------------------------------------------------- /examples/splits/sv2_planes_train.json: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/ZhengZerong/DeepImplicitTemplates/HEAD/examples/splits/sv2_planes_train.json -------------------------------------------------------------------------------- /examples/splits/sv2_sofas_test.json: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/ZhengZerong/DeepImplicitTemplates/HEAD/examples/splits/sv2_sofas_test.json -------------------------------------------------------------------------------- /examples/splits/sv2_sofas_train.json: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/ZhengZerong/DeepImplicitTemplates/HEAD/examples/splits/sv2_sofas_train.json -------------------------------------------------------------------------------- /examples/splits/sv2_tables_test.json: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/ZhengZerong/DeepImplicitTemplates/HEAD/examples/splits/sv2_tables_test.json -------------------------------------------------------------------------------- /examples/splits/sv2_tables_train.json: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/ZhengZerong/DeepImplicitTemplates/HEAD/examples/splits/sv2_tables_train.json -------------------------------------------------------------------------------- /generate_meshes_correspondence.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/ZhengZerong/DeepImplicitTemplates/HEAD/generate_meshes_correspondence.py -------------------------------------------------------------------------------- /generate_template_mesh.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/ZhengZerong/DeepImplicitTemplates/HEAD/generate_template_mesh.py -------------------------------------------------------------------------------- /generate_training_meshes.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/ZhengZerong/DeepImplicitTemplates/HEAD/generate_training_meshes.py -------------------------------------------------------------------------------- /networks/deep_implicit_template_decoder.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/ZhengZerong/DeepImplicitTemplates/HEAD/networks/deep_implicit_template_decoder.py -------------------------------------------------------------------------------- /objio.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/ZhengZerong/DeepImplicitTemplates/HEAD/objio.py -------------------------------------------------------------------------------- /plot_log.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/ZhengZerong/DeepImplicitTemplates/HEAD/plot_log.py -------------------------------------------------------------------------------- /plot_log_multiple.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/ZhengZerong/DeepImplicitTemplates/HEAD/plot_log_multiple.py -------------------------------------------------------------------------------- /pretrained/cars_dit/LatentCodes/2000.pth: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/ZhengZerong/DeepImplicitTemplates/HEAD/pretrained/cars_dit/LatentCodes/2000.pth -------------------------------------------------------------------------------- /pretrained/cars_dit/LatentCodes/latest.pth: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/ZhengZerong/DeepImplicitTemplates/HEAD/pretrained/cars_dit/LatentCodes/latest.pth -------------------------------------------------------------------------------- /pretrained/cars_dit/ModelParameters/2000.pth: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/ZhengZerong/DeepImplicitTemplates/HEAD/pretrained/cars_dit/ModelParameters/2000.pth -------------------------------------------------------------------------------- /pretrained/cars_dit/ModelParameters/latest.pth: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/ZhengZerong/DeepImplicitTemplates/HEAD/pretrained/cars_dit/ModelParameters/latest.pth -------------------------------------------------------------------------------- /pretrained/cars_dit/specs.json: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/ZhengZerong/DeepImplicitTemplates/HEAD/pretrained/cars_dit/specs.json -------------------------------------------------------------------------------- /pretrained/chairs_dit/LatentCodes/2000.pth: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/ZhengZerong/DeepImplicitTemplates/HEAD/pretrained/chairs_dit/LatentCodes/2000.pth -------------------------------------------------------------------------------- /pretrained/chairs_dit/LatentCodes/latest.pth: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/ZhengZerong/DeepImplicitTemplates/HEAD/pretrained/chairs_dit/LatentCodes/latest.pth -------------------------------------------------------------------------------- /pretrained/chairs_dit/ModelParameters/2000.pth: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/ZhengZerong/DeepImplicitTemplates/HEAD/pretrained/chairs_dit/ModelParameters/2000.pth -------------------------------------------------------------------------------- /pretrained/chairs_dit/ModelParameters/latest.pth: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/ZhengZerong/DeepImplicitTemplates/HEAD/pretrained/chairs_dit/ModelParameters/latest.pth -------------------------------------------------------------------------------- /pretrained/chairs_dit/specs.json: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/ZhengZerong/DeepImplicitTemplates/HEAD/pretrained/chairs_dit/specs.json -------------------------------------------------------------------------------- /pretrained/planes_dit/LatentCodes/2000.pth: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/ZhengZerong/DeepImplicitTemplates/HEAD/pretrained/planes_dit/LatentCodes/2000.pth -------------------------------------------------------------------------------- /pretrained/planes_dit/LatentCodes/latest.pth: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/ZhengZerong/DeepImplicitTemplates/HEAD/pretrained/planes_dit/LatentCodes/latest.pth -------------------------------------------------------------------------------- /pretrained/planes_dit/ModelParameters/2000.pth: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/ZhengZerong/DeepImplicitTemplates/HEAD/pretrained/planes_dit/ModelParameters/2000.pth -------------------------------------------------------------------------------- /pretrained/planes_dit/ModelParameters/latest.pth: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/ZhengZerong/DeepImplicitTemplates/HEAD/pretrained/planes_dit/ModelParameters/latest.pth -------------------------------------------------------------------------------- /pretrained/planes_dit/specs.json: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/ZhengZerong/DeepImplicitTemplates/HEAD/pretrained/planes_dit/specs.json -------------------------------------------------------------------------------- /pretrained/sofas_dit/LatentCodes/2000.pth: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/ZhengZerong/DeepImplicitTemplates/HEAD/pretrained/sofas_dit/LatentCodes/2000.pth -------------------------------------------------------------------------------- /pretrained/sofas_dit/LatentCodes/latest.pth: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/ZhengZerong/DeepImplicitTemplates/HEAD/pretrained/sofas_dit/LatentCodes/latest.pth -------------------------------------------------------------------------------- /pretrained/sofas_dit/ModelParameters/2000.pth: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/ZhengZerong/DeepImplicitTemplates/HEAD/pretrained/sofas_dit/ModelParameters/2000.pth -------------------------------------------------------------------------------- /pretrained/sofas_dit/ModelParameters/latest.pth: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/ZhengZerong/DeepImplicitTemplates/HEAD/pretrained/sofas_dit/ModelParameters/latest.pth -------------------------------------------------------------------------------- /pretrained/sofas_dit/specs.json: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/ZhengZerong/DeepImplicitTemplates/HEAD/pretrained/sofas_dit/specs.json -------------------------------------------------------------------------------- /reconstruct_deep_implicit_templates.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/ZhengZerong/DeepImplicitTemplates/HEAD/reconstruct_deep_implicit_templates.py -------------------------------------------------------------------------------- /render_correspondences.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/ZhengZerong/DeepImplicitTemplates/HEAD/render_correspondences.py -------------------------------------------------------------------------------- /train_deep_implicit_templates.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/ZhengZerong/DeepImplicitTemplates/HEAD/train_deep_implicit_templates.py --------------------------------------------------------------------------------